Three injured  to be sent to Delhi
0
SHARES
7
VIEWS
Share on FacebookShare on Twitter

Agartala July 15: On June 28, eight people died in an upside-down chariot accident at Kumarghat. Many were injured. Among them, three seriously injured are under treatment at GB Hospital. They need better treatment. The state government feels that they need more advanced treatment by sending them to Delhi. Accordingly, the government has decided to send them to Delhi for better treatment. Two patients were flown to Delhi on Saturday. One more patient will be sent to Delhi on Sunday.

This morning, Chief Minister Dr. Manik Saha went to GB Hospital to inquire about their physical condition. Talk to doctors and health workers. After inquiring about the physical condition of the injured, the chief minister said that the condition of three was serious. Their condition is currently stable. Still they are being sent to Delhi for better treatment. For this, the doctors of the state have talked to the doctors of Delhi through video conference. The doctors of Delhi said that the three injured patients have received very good treatment. The Chief Minister said that the rest of the services will be provided to Delhi now. Health Secretary Dr Debashish Bose along with other officials were also present with the Chief Minister.
